Book excerpt: This unique textbook comprehensively introduces the field of discrete event systems, offering a breadth of coverage that makes the material accessible to readers of varied backgrounds. The book emphasizes a unified modeling framework that transcends specific application areas, linking the following topics in a coherent manner: language and automata theory, supervisory control, Petri net theory, Markov chains and queueing theory, discrete-event simulation, and concurrent estimation techniques. Topics and features: detailed treatment of automata and language theory in the context of discrete event systems, including application to state estimation and diagnosis comprehensive coverage of centralized and decentralized supervisory control of partially-observed systems timed models, including timed automata and hybrid automata stochastic models for discrete event systems and controlled Markov chains discrete event simulation an introduction to stochastic hybrid systems sensitivity analysis and optimization of discrete event and hybrid systems new in the third edition: opacity properties, enhanced coverage of supervisory control, overview of latest software tools This proven textbook is essential to advanced-level students and researchers in a variety of disciplines where the study of discrete event systems is relevant: control, communications, computer engineering, computer science, manufacturing engineering, transportation networks, operations research, and industrial engineering. ​Christos G. Book excerpt: This book concerns the use of dioid algebra as (max, +) algebra to treat the synchronization of tasks expressed by the maximum of the ends of the tasks conditioning the beginning of another task – a criterion of linear programming. A classical example is the departure time of a train which should wait for the arrival of other trains in order to allow for the changeover of passengers. The content focuses on the modeling of a class of dynamic systems usually called “discrete event systems” where the timing of the events is crucial. Events are viewed as sudden changes in a process which is, essentially, a man-made system, such as automated manufacturing lines or transportation systems. Its main advantage is its formalism which allows us to clearly describe complex notions and the possibilities to transpose theoretical results between dioids and practical applications.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Un Système de production peut être représenté par les systèmes à événements discrets. En dehors de la planification (où les gens travaillent avec des ratios de produits fabriqués par semaine ou par jour), la modélisation pourrait être basée sur les concepts d'événement et d'activités. Un événement correspond à un changement d'état. Une activité est une boîte noire d'encapsulation de ce qui se passe entre deux événements. En utilisant les réseaux de Petri (RdP), les événements sont représentés par les transitions, et les activités par les lieux. Notre travail propose une synthèse de commande par supervision pour les systèmes d'événements discrets modélisés par une classe de réseaux de Petri appelé graphe d'événements. L'objective de cette thèse est de concevoir un superviseur capable d'aider à améliorer la performance de système et de protéger le système en respectant des spécifications données par le fabricant ou le client selon les besoins et les conditions de travail. Pour modéliser ces spécifications, nous avons proposé un nouveau modèle mathématique de contrainte, appelé Contrainte d'Exclusion de Marquage (CEM). La deuxième contribution principale de ma thèse est de synthétiser une technique efficace et simple pour construire un superviseur qui impose le système de respecter des contraintes en évitant l'ensemble des états interdits modélisé par CEM. Nous avons également développé cette synthèse pour résoudre le problème d'existence des événements incontrôlables et des événements inobservables. Parfois, afin d'étudier les aspects liés à la performance, nous devons prendre le temps en considération. Donc, nous avons résolu aussi le problème des événements temporisé en utilisant RdP temporisés soumis à CEM.

Book excerpt: Dans ce travail, nous proposons deux méthodes originales d'identification d'une classe de systèmes à événements discrets (SED) modélisables par réseaux de Petri (RdP). La première méthode consiste à utiliser les signaux de sortie du système afin d'élaborer son modèle comportemental sous la forme d'un RdP. Les conditions nécessaires et suffisantes pour garantir l'unicité de la solution sont établies. Par ailleurs, le problème d'identification d'un SED est défini sous la forme d'un problème de programmation linéaire binaire. Quant à la deuxième méthode, elle est basée sur l'analyse des signaux d'entrée et de sortie mesurables du système considéré. Elle consiste à déterminer la partie mesurable et à estimer la partie non mesurable puis, à calculer la structure et le marquage initial du RdP à identifier. Par ailleurs, deux approches de synthèse de contrôleur RdP sont proposées. Ces derniers permettent de raffiner les modèles issus de la première phase en inhibant, quand c’est nécessaire, l’atteignabilité des états interdit. Les résultats obtenus dans ce travail ont été validés sur un système réel

Book excerpt: The first motivation of Synthesis and Control of Discrete Event Systems is to inform the reader of recent developments and current trends in system synthesis. This is a field of active research aiming to supply efficient techniques for developing safe systems in various areas, covering control of embedded and manufacturing systems, distributed implementation of systems and protocols, and hardware circuits. In all areas, considerations about distribution and care for an efficient implementation of the synthesised systems play an increasing role, justified by better applicability to problems encountered in the design of practical systems. The second motivation of the book, which is a selection of presentations given at two workshops on synthesis of controllers and on synthesis of concurrent systems, is to incite the research community to establish stronger links between two subjects that could be better related, as several presentations do show. The selected papers are research papers ranging from theory to practice, with automata, products of automata and Petri nets playing a prominent role. All areas mentioned above as areas of application of system synthesis are covered by some of the selected papers.
